服务器测评网
我们一直在努力

如何准确执行指定路径下的Java文件?详细步骤解析与疑问解答。

在Java开发过程中,执行一个Java文件通常需要遵循一系列步骤,以下是如何执行一个Java文件的详细指南,包括必要的步骤和注意事项。

如何准确执行指定路径下的Java文件?详细步骤解析与疑问解答。

编写Java代码

确保你已经编写了一个Java程序,以下是一个简单的Java程序示例:

public class HelloWorld {
    public static void main(String[] args) {
        System.out.println("Hello, World!");
    }
}

保存Java文件

将上述代码保存到一个文件中,通常以.java为扩展名,可以将文件命名为HelloWorld.java

设置Java开发环境

确保你的计算机上已经安装了Java开发工具包(JDK),你可以通过以下命令检查JDK是否已正确安装:

java -version

如果JDK已安装,该命令将显示Java的版本信息。

编译Java文件

在命令行中,切换到包含HelloWorld.java文件的目录,使用javac命令编译Java文件:

如何准确执行指定路径下的Java文件?详细步骤解析与疑问解答。

javac HelloWorld.java

如果编译成功,命令行将不会显示任何输出,如果出现错误,javac将输出错误信息,你需要根据错误信息进行修改。

执行编译后的Java文件

一旦Java文件编译成功,你可以使用java命令来执行它:

java HelloWorld

如果一切正常,你将在命令行看到输出:

Hello, World!

路径问题处理

在执行Java文件时,可能会遇到路径问题,以下是一些常见的情况和解决方案:

1. 文件无法找到

如果你在执行Java文件时收到“找不到或无法加载主类”的错误,可能是因为以下原因:

如何准确执行指定路径下的Java文件?详细步骤解析与疑问解答。

  • 原因:编译后的.class文件不在当前目录下。
  • 解决方案:确保你的当前目录包含编译后的.class文件,或者使用完整的文件路径来执行Java文件。

2. 类路径(Classpath)问题

如果你的Java程序需要访问外部库或资源,你可能需要设置类路径:

  • 原因:Java虚拟机(JVM)无法找到所需的类或资源。
  • 解决方案:使用-cp-classpath选项来指定类路径。
java -cp .:lib/* HelloWorld

这里,代表当前目录,lib/*代表lib目录下的所有文件。

注意事项

  • 确保Java文件名与类名完全匹配,包括大小写。
  • 使用合适的文件名和目录结构,以便于管理和维护。
  • 在执行Java程序时,确保你拥有足够的权限。

通过遵循上述步骤,你可以成功地执行一个Java文件,良好的实践和注意细节对于确保开发过程的顺利进行至关重要。

赞(0)
未经允许不得转载:好主机测评网 » 如何准确执行指定路径下的Java文件?详细步骤解析与疑问解答。